Geçerli Olduğu Versiyon: Emakin 5 ve üzeri


Açıklama


Emakin'e yüklenebilecek dosya formatlarına sınır getirmek için izin verilecek veya kısıtlanacak uzantılar mimeType ile, ..\6Kare\AltiKare\Web\Configuration\workflow.config dosyasında belirtilir.


Çözüm


İzin verilmek istenen uzantılar aşağıdaki gibi yazılmalıdır. İzin verilenler dışındakiler otomatik olarak kısıtlanacaktır.

<workflow>
    <applications>
      <add name="bulentemakin.com" staticUrl="http://tugrul.bulentemakin.com" connectionName="global" useSSL="false" systemAdmin="bulent.yuksel@6kare.com">
        <allowedFileTypes>
            <add extension="*" mimeType="application/octet-stream" />
            <add extension="pdf" mimeType="application/pdf" />
            <add extension="docx" mimeType="application/vnd.openxmlformats-officedocument.wordprocessingml.document" />
            <add extension="doc" mimeType="*" />
            <add extension="xls" mimeType="application/vnd.ms-excel" />
            <add extension="xlsx" mimeType="application/vnd.openxmlformats-officedocument.spreadsheetml.sheet" />
            <add extension="eml" mimeType="application/octet-stream" />
        </allowedFileTypes>
     

Kısıtlanmak istenen uzantılar aşağıdaki gibi yazılmalıdır. Kısıtlanan dışındakiler otomatik olarak izin verilecektir.

<workflow>
    <applications>
      <add name="bulentemakin.com" staticUrl="http://tugrul.bulentemakin.com" connectionName="global" useSSL="false" systemAdmin="bulent.yuksel@6kare.com">   
         <deniedFileTypes>
              <add extension="exe" mimeType="*" />
         </deniedFileTypes>